The Giants' journey to assemble their current quarterback room was filled with twists and turns. They explored various options, including trades for established veterans like Matthew Stafford and pursuing big names like Aaron Rodgers. Ultimately, they signed Russell Wilson and Jameis Winston and drafted Jaxson Dart, creating a blend of experience and potential.
The decision to draft Dart over Shedeur Sanders was a key moment. While Sanders had supporters within the organization, Dart's performance during the evaluation process, particularly his meetings and workouts, ultimately won over the Giants' decision-makers.
